Home
About Us
Services
Our Clients
Localization
Contact Us
Home
Our Clients
BSI logo – 8 point media client – digital marketing agency
BSI logo – 8 point media client – digital marketing agency
BSI logo – 8 point media client – digital marketing agency
Leave a Reply
Cancel reply
post a comment